Использование обратных тиков в улье со специальными символами

79
9

У меня есть встроенный запрос улья, чтобы извлечь значения и сохранить их в переменной, используя обратные тики со специальными символами, сколько экранирующих символов должно быть определено около @, чтобы выполнить следующий запрос.

Table_Name='hive -S -e " Select tbl_name, \
regexp_replace(concat_ws(',',collect_set(cast(table_name as string))),' ','@') as tbl_name \
from table_a \
lateral view explode(tbl_name) as table_name and table_id='$table_number'"'

спросил(а) 2019-05-15T19:34:00+03:00 9 месяцев, 2 недели назад
0
Ваш ответ
Введите минимум 50 символов
Чтобы , пожалуйста,
Выберите тему жалобы:

Другая проблема